Last Week at Santa Anita Park (Feb 19-21)

Following a special 5-day week of live racing, Santa Anita's live action was limited to three days last week. 

Flavien Prat was the jockey star with a pair of riding doubles. Main track speed was strong on Sunday.  



Friday Santa Anita Park Recap: February 19
Fast main track and off the turf. Three wire-to-wire winners (6.5f, 6.5f, 8f).
Joe Talamo booted home the late double.
Saturday Santa Anita Park Recap: February 20 
Fast main track and good turf course. Stalking types dominated on dirt. A 9f closer and a flat mile stalker made up the two turf winners.
Flavien Prat guided home two winners. Doug O’Neill saddled two winners.
Sunday Santa Anita Park Recap: February 21
Fast main track and good turf course. Five wire-to-wire winners on dirt (6f, 8.5f, 6.5f, 5.5f, 5.5f). A stalker and a closer (both a one mile) made up the two turf winners.
Hat trick for Santiago Gonzalez. Riding double for Flavien Prat. Two winners for trainer John Sadler.

Last Week at Santa Anita Park (Feb 11-15)

Santa Anita Park hosted a special 5-day holiday racing week ending with juvenile champ and Kentucky Derby 2016 contender Nyquist cruising in his much anticipated return on Monday, Feb 15. 



Thursday Santa Anita Park Recap: February 11
Fast main track and firm turf course. Early/pressing types dominated on dirt (2 wire jobs – 7f, 6.5f). Both downhill sprints were won in wire-to-wire fashion (turf rail at 10 feet).
No riding/training doubles on Thursday.

Friday Santa Anita Park Recap: February 12
Fast main track and firm turf course. Early/pressing types dominated on dirt (5 wire jobs – 8f, 6f, 7f, 6f, 8f). The lone turf race (downhill sprint) was won in wire-to-wire fashion (turf rail at 30 feet).
Four-bagger for Santiago Gonzalez. Steve Miyadi saddled two winners.

Saturday Santa Anita Park Recap: February 13
Fast main track and firm turf course (turf rail at 10 feet). Two wire-to-wire winners at six furlongs on dirt. Stalking types captures all three turf races (8f, 6.5f, 9f).
Hat trick for Flavien Prat. Edwin Maldonado booted home a pair. Phil D’Amato saddled two winners and Maldonado rode two. 

Sunday Santa Anita Park Recap: February 14 
Fast main track and firm turf course. Main track was much less speed favoring (1 wire job – 8.5f). Two patient runners (6.5f, 12f) and a downhill presser made up the three turf winners.
Kent Desormeaux booted home the early double.
Monday Santa Anita Park Recap: February 15 
Fast main track and firm turf course (turf rail at 20 feet). Four wire job winners on dirt (5.5f, 8.5f, 7f, 6f). Stalking types captured all three turf races (8f, 8f, 6.5f).
Tyler Baze and Rafael Bejarano both booted home a pair.

Last Week at Santa Anita Park (Feb 4-7)

The main track was not as wire-to-wire friendly (7 wire jobs) and it was a good week for Rafael Bejarano and Bob Baffert

Thursday Santa Anita Park Recap: February 4
Fast main track and good turf course (rail at 30 feet). Edge to early/pressing types on dirt (2 wire jobs – 6f, 8f). Stalkers won both turf races (9f, 6.5f).
Rafael Bejarano guided home a pair. Phil D’Amato saddled two turf winners.
Friday Santa Anita Park Recap: February 5 
Fast main track and good turf course (rail at 20 feet). Edge to early/pressing types on dirt (1 wire job – 8.5f). Patient runners (9f, 8f) won the two turf routes on the card.
Riding double for Rafael Bejarano.
Saturday Santa Anita Park Recap: February 6
Fast main track and good turf course. Edge to early/pressing types on dirt (3 wire jobs – 6f, 6f, 8f). A downhill stalker, a flat mile stalker, and a patient runner at 10f won the three turf races on the card.
Edwin Maldonado booted home a pair. Bob Baffert saddled three winners including Mor Spirit in the G2 Robert Lewis Stakes.
Sunday Santa Anita Park Recap: February 7
Fast main track and good turf course. Edge to early/pressing types on dirt (1 wire job – 7f).Kobe’s Back was the only late runner to win on dirt. A flat mile stalker and two patient runners at 9f won the three turf races on the card (turf rail at 10 feet).
No riding/training doubles on Sunday.

Last Week at Santa Anita Park (Jan 28-31)

The race week began with fast, dry conditions and ended with a wet, speed favoring track (off the turf) on Sunday.

Thursday Santa Anita Park Recap: January 28
Fast main track and good turf course (turf rail at 20 feet). Early/pressing types dominated on dirt (5 wire jobs – 6.5f, 8f, 5.5f, 6f, 6f).  A downhill stalker and a 9f wire job made up the two turf winners.
Riding double for Joe TalamoVladimir Cerin saddled two winners.

Friday Santa Anita Park Recap: January 29
Fast main track and good turf course (turf rail at 30 feet). Early/pressing types dominated again on dirt (4 wire jobs – 9f, 8f, 7f, 5.5f).  A flat mile wire job and a downhill stalker made up the two turf winners.
Riding double for Flavien Prat.
Saturday Santa Anita Park Recap: January 30
Fast main track and good turf course. Early/pressing types strong again on dirt (4 wire jobs – 6f, 8.5f, 6f, 6f).  A downhill stalker, a flat mile presser, another downhill stalker, and a 9f presser made up the four turf winners.
Riding doubles for Kent Desormeaux (turf stakes) and apprentice David Lopez (6f dirt sprints). Phil D’Amato saddled two dirt sprint winners including Sunday Rules in the Cal Cup Sprint.
Sunday Santa Anita Park Recap: January 31 
Wet fast (sealed) main track and off the turf. Early/pressing types dominated on dirt (6 wire jobs – 8f, 8f, 8f, 6.5f, 6f, 6.5f).
Rafael Bejarano guided home three winners. Flavien Prat booted home a pair. Trainer David Jacobson saddled his first winner of the meet (Can Can Babe in the opener) and finished a close 2nd with Eighty Three in the 7th race.
Final Thoughts: Speed ruled at Santa Anita Park with 19 wire-to-wire winners on the main track. A couple of riding doubles for Flavien Prat made him the riding star of the week.
